HALFMOON -- Nancy Bast, who cofounded the Halfmoon-based construction firm Bast Hatfield Inc. with her husband in the late 1970s, died Monday after a long illness. She was 65.
Bast Hatfield, which employs 200 people, has been one of the largest general contractors in the Capital Region and at its height brought in $100 million in annual revenue and employed 400. Major projects have ranged from Rensselaer Polytechnic Institute's Center for Biotechnology and Interdisciplinary Studies in Troy, to the YMCA in Saratoga Springs and the Christmas Tree Shops at Colonie Center.
